Nurturing
After a long swim I peel my nails back from my wet wrinkled skin to find orange juice and seawater sun lying just within the horizon line
I stick it in my mouth to taste the warm sound of nursery toast and buttered rhymes
Somewhere a lime meringue collapses
How beautiful it is to be loved like this.
By M.P. Parker
